Output ef9586934020902ddb8e012ea68ca4a88a7e1bcb3e8efae6d3dc2f18e78a63d3:0

value
58208470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1d75544fc1df62a5af8c7911467e3081ee0140 OP_EQUAL
address
MEvuZ11P5tDHrJE3c9cVBbzfajUi4vpTZR
transaction
ef9586934020902ddb8e012ea68ca4a88a7e1bcb3e8efae6d3dc2f18e78a63d3
spent
true